What will you take care of?

with this 6 months Digital Sales & Operations Internship, you will support the Automotive Aftermarket Sales Team in improving daily commercial and logistics activities through digital tools, data analysis and artificial intelligence.

You will work in a dynamic sales environment, closely interacting with commercial, supply chain and operational stakeholders, with the goal of automating low value-added activities and enabling the team to focus on high value-added tasks.

Help shaping the future: You will actively contribute to the digital evolution of sales and logistics processes, proposing new ideas and practical solutions.

Take on responsibility, you will:

  • Support sales and logistics activities through data analysis and smart automation tools
  • Develop and maintain dashboards and reports to monitor commercial and operational KPIs
  • Use AI-based tools to simplify repetitive tasks (e.g. reporting, data preparation, analysis)
  • Collaborate with the team to identify process inefficiencies and propose improvement ideas
  • Act as a bridge between business needs and digital solutions
  • Create clear and effective visualizations for non-technical stakeholders
  • Work in an international environment, interacting with colleagues worldwide

What distinguishes you?

Education: Master’s student (or recent graduate) in Management Engineering, Digital Business, or similar fields with a strong interest in sales and business processes

Know-how & Skills:

  • Basic knowledge of data analysis and digital tools
  • Interest in automation, AI and business intelligence (hands-on experience is a plus, not mandatory)
  • Familiarity with tools such as Microsoft Office, Power BI or similar and with programming languages such as Python is an advantage
  • Basic understanding of sales or supply chain processes is a plus

Personality & Soft Skills

  • Strong communication skills and ability to work in a team
  • Proactive mindset: you don’t just execute, you propose
  • Curiosity and willingness to learn
  • Practical, problem-solving attitude
  • Ability to translate data into business insights Languages: Fluent Italian; Good knowledge of English B2/C1

What We Offer:

  • Duration:6 Months Full Time Internship (Curricular or Extracurricular);
  • Internships foresee reimbursement at Bosch Italia, for undergraduate students or holders of a Bachelor’s degree, a monthly allowance of €700 is provided, in addition to access to the company canteen. For candidates holding a Master’s degree or an additional academic qualification, a monthly allowance of €900 is provided, together with access to the company canteen.
  • The internship commencement date is expected to fall between early March and early April.

Robert Bosch GmbH is a multinational engineering and technology company that develops automotive components, industrial technology, consumer goods, and energy solutions. The company operates across multiple sectors including mobility solutions, industrial technology, consumer goods, and building technologies.
